ZÁKOLANY

Province: Středočeský Kraj
District (Okres) : Kladno

Arms (crest) of Zákolany

Official blazon

V červeném štítě románská rotunda se dvěma prázdnými okny, k níž zprava přiléhá věž se dvěma románskými sdruženými okny nad sebou a dvojitou valbovou střechou s makovicí, vše stříbrné.

Origin/meaning

The arms were registered on November 28, 2000. They contain a stylized depiction of the local Budeč rotunda Church of St. Peter and Paul from the end of the 9th century.
